本發明係有關於一種語音管理裝置,且特別有關於一種可以進行語音錄製並對於語音進行識別之裝置及其操作方法。The present invention relates to a voice management device, and more particularly to an apparatus that can perform voice recording and recognize voice and an operation method thereof.

目前來說,開會已經幾乎成為上班族每天的既定行程之一。準備開會資料、進行會議、會議過程中的記錄、及會議後的檢討與整理不僅繁瑣且往往必須花費大量的時間,從而造成人們的極大困擾。At present, the meeting has almost become one of the established itineraries of office workers every day. Preparing meeting materials, conducting meetings, recording during the meeting, and reviewing and organizing after the meeting are not only cumbersome but often require a lot of time, which causes great trouble.

傳統上,會議記錄係由人力透過紙筆完成,其係非常缺乏效率。由於現代電子裝置的進步,錄音裝置可以用來取代紙筆,以將會議過程中產生的語音進行記錄。然而,錄音裝置所錄製的語音係將會議過程全部錄製為一個檔案。會議過後,仍須由人力來解讀與分析不同會議參予者所述之內容。此過程亦係非常耗費人力資源,且缺乏效率。Traditionally, meeting minutes have been done by manpower through paper and pencil, which is very inefficient. Due to advances in modern electronic devices, recording devices can be used to replace paper and pencil to record speech generated during a meeting. However, the voice recorded by the recording device records the entire conference process as a file. After the meeting, it is still necessary for human resources to interpret and analyze the content described by different conference participants. This process is also very labor intensive and inefficient.

有鑑於此,本發明提供語音管理裝置及其操作方法,其中,語音可以被進行錄製且進行識別。In view of this, the present invention provides a voice management apparatus and an operation method thereof, in which voice can be recorded and recognized.

本發明實施例之一種語音管理裝置至少包括一語音接收模組與一處理單元。語音接收模組包括複數收音單元,用以分別接收一特定語音。處理單元依據每一收音單元於電子裝置中所設置的位置及每一收音單元分別接收之特定語音之聲音大小決定特定語音相應之一特定識別資料。A voice management apparatus according to an embodiment of the present invention includes at least a voice receiving module and a processing unit. The voice receiving module includes a plurality of sound receiving units for respectively receiving a specific voice. The processing unit determines one specific identification data corresponding to the specific voice according to the position set by each of the sounding units in the electronic device and the sound size of the specific voice received by each of the sounding units.

本發明實施例之一種語音管理方法。首先,透過一語音接收模組之複數收音單元分別接收一特定語音。之後,依據每一收音單元於電子裝置中所設置的位置及每一收音單元分別接收之特定語音之聲音大小決定特定語音相應之一特定識別資料。A voice management method according to an embodiment of the present invention. First, a specific sound is received by a plurality of sound receiving units of a voice receiving module. Then, according to the position set by each of the sounding units in the electronic device and the sound size of the specific voice received by each of the sounding units, one specific identification data corresponding to the specific voice is determined.

第1圖顯示依據本發明實施例之語音管理裝置。如第1圖所示,依據本發明實施例之語音管理裝置100可以至少包括一語音接收模組110、與一處理單元120。注意的是,語音管理裝置100可以適用於一電子裝置。語音接收模組110可以包括至少一收音單元,用以接收電子裝置週遭的語音。值得注意的是,在一些實施例中,收音單元可以包括一麥克風,用以接收語音。處理單元112可以控制語音管理裝置100中相關軟體與硬體之作業,並執行本案之語音管理方法,其細節將於後進行說明。值得注意的是,在一些實施例中,語音管理裝置100可以包括複數發光單元(第1圖中未顯示)。語音透過語音接收模組110之至少一收音單元接收時,處理單元112可以控制發光單元中之至少一者進行發光。值得注意的是,在一些實施例中,語音管理裝置100可以包括一顯示單元(第1圖中未顯示),用以顯示相關資料,如影像、介面與/或資料等。在一些實施例中,語音管理裝置100可以包括一網路連接單元(第1圖中未顯示)。網路連接單元可以連接至一網路,如有線網路、電信網路、與無線網路等。藉由網路連接單元,語音管理裝置100可以具有一網路接取能力,以與其他具有網路連接能力之電子裝置進行耦接。再者,在一些實施例中,語音管理裝置100可以具有一儲存單元(第1圖中未顯示)。儲存單元可以儲存相關資料,如透過語音接收模組110之至少一收音單元所接收之語音。Figure 1 shows a voice management device in accordance with an embodiment of the present invention. As shown in FIG. 1 , the voice management device 100 according to the embodiment of the present invention may include at least one voice receiving module 110 and one processing unit 120. Note that the voice management device 100 can be applied to an electronic device. The voice receiving module 110 can include at least one sound receiving unit for receiving voices around the electronic device. It should be noted that in some embodiments, the sound unit may include a microphone for receiving voice. The processing unit 112 can control the operations of the related software and hardware in the voice management device 100, and execute the voice management method of the present invention, the details of which will be described later. It should be noted that in some embodiments, the voice management device 100 can include a plurality of lighting units (not shown in FIG. 1). When the voice is received by at least one of the sound receiving units of the voice receiving module 110, the processing unit 112 can control at least one of the light emitting units to emit light. It should be noted that, in some embodiments, the voice management device 100 can include a display unit (not shown in FIG. 1) for displaying related materials, such as images, interfaces, and/or materials. In some embodiments, the voice management device 100 can include a network connection unit (not shown in FIG. 1). The network connection unit can be connected to a network such as a wired network, a telecommunications network, and a wireless network. Through the network connection unit, the voice management device 100 can have a network access capability to be coupled with other electronic devices having network connectivity. Moreover, in some embodiments, the voice management device 100 can have a storage unit (not shown in FIG. 1). The storage unit can store related data, such as voice received by at least one of the sound receiving units of the voice receiving module 110.

第2圖顯示依據本發明實施例之語音管理裝置例子。值得注意的是,在此例子中,語音管理裝置200可以設計為一圓柱體。其中,語音接收模組可以包括三個收音單元(111、112、113),如麥克風,且相互間等距地設置於語音管理裝置200之中,如第2圖所示。另外,語音管理裝置200具有多個發光單元(131~139),如LED(Light Emitting Diode,發光二極體),且相互間等距地設置於語音管理裝置200之中,如第2圖所示。提醒的是,第2圖中所揭示之語音管理裝置的形狀、收音單元的數目、及發光單元的數目及其設置於裝置中的位置僅為本案之例子,本發明並不限定於此。Figure 2 shows an example of a voice management device in accordance with an embodiment of the present invention. It is worth noting that in this example, the voice management device 200 can be designed as a cylinder. The voice receiving module may include three sounding units (111, 112, 113), such as microphones, and are disposed equidistantly from each other in the voice management device 200, as shown in FIG. In addition, the voice management device 200 has a plurality of light emitting units (131 to 139), such as LEDs (Light Emitting Diodes), and is disposed equidistantly from each other in the voice management device 200, as shown in FIG. Show. It is to be noted that the shape of the voice management device disclosed in FIG. 2, the number of sound pickup units, and the number of light emitting units and their positions in the device are merely examples of the present invention, and the present invention is not limited thereto.

舉例來說,當4人圍繞著語音管理裝置進行會議,並發出語音。當第一人物發言時,語音管理裝置會依據每一收音單元於語音管理裝置中所設置的位置及每一收音單元分別接收之語音之聲音大小識別出此第一人物相應於語音管理裝置之位置(第一識別資料),並致使最接近第一人物的發光單元進行發光。當另一第二人物發言時,類似地,語音管理裝置會依據每一收音單元於語音管理裝置中所設置的位置及每一收音單元分別接收之語音之聲音大小識別出此第二人物相應於語音管理裝置之位置(第二識別資料),並致使最接近第二人物的發光單元進行發光。For example, when four people are conducting a conference around a voice management device, a voice is emitted. When the first character speaks, the voice management device identifies the location of the first character corresponding to the voice management device according to the position set by each of the sounding units in the voice management device and the voice sound received by each of the sounding units respectively. (first identification material) and causing the light-emitting unit closest to the first person to emit light. Similarly, when the second character speaks, the voice management device recognizes that the second character corresponds to the position set by each of the sounding units in the voice management device and the voice sound received by each of the sounding units respectively. The position of the voice management device (the second identification material) causes the light-emitting unit closest to the second person to emit light.

接下來,舉一語音管理例子進行說明,其中,多人圍繞著語音管理裝置進行會議,並發言。當每人發言時,語音管理裝置便將其語音進行識別,並記錄。在此例子中,使用者1至使用者6分別進行發言, 語音管理裝置陸續識別接收之語音,並將其分別顯示為視覺化部件(VP1、VP2、VP3、VP4、VP5、VP6),如第10圖所示。提醒的是,當使用者介面UI無法顯示全部的視覺化部件時,視覺化部件可以被向上移動,換言之,相應最早記錄語音的視覺化部件將會被移出使用者介面UI之顯示範圍。提醒的是,視覺化部件可以係顯示於語音管理裝置或與語音管理裝置耦接之特定裝置,在語音管理裝置接收到相應使用者6之語音時,特定裝置可以接收到相應此段語音之註解N1。在一些實施例中,當接收到註解N1時,相應之視覺化部件VP6會向上移動至最上方,如第11圖所示,以凸顯此註解N1係相應於視覺化部件VP6之語音。必須說明的是,註解N1與視覺化部件VP6及其相應之語音可以依據其接收/記錄的時間來進行關聯。之後,使用者7與使用者8分別進行發言,語音管理裝置陸續識別接收之語音,並將其分別顯示為視覺化部件(VP7、VP8),如第12圖所示。類似地,在語音管理裝置接收到相應使用者8之語音時,特定裝置可以接收到相應此段語音之註解N2。必須注意的是,前述例子中每一段語音皆係以不同的使用者角度說明。然而,在一些例子中,不同片段之語音可能是相應同一使用者。接收之語音是否係相應至同一使用者可以依據每一收音單元於電子裝置中所設置的位置及每一收音單元分別接收之特定語音之聲音大小與/或聲紋比對之結果來決定。Next, a voice management example will be described, in which a plurality of people conduct a conference around the voice management device and speak. When each person speaks, the voice management device recognizes its voice and records it. In this example, User 1 to User 6 respectively speak. The voice management device successively recognizes the received voice and displays it as a visual component (VP1, VP2, VP3, VP4, VP5, VP6), as shown in FIG. It is reminded that when the user interface UI cannot display all the visual components, the visualization component can be moved upwards, in other words, the visual component corresponding to the earliest recorded voice will be removed from the display range of the user interface UI. It is reminded that the visual component can be displayed on the voice management device or a specific device coupled to the voice management device. When the voice management device receives the voice of the corresponding user 6, the specific device can receive the annotation corresponding to the voice. N1. In some embodiments, upon receipt of the annotation N1, the corresponding visualization component VP6 will move up to the top, as shown in FIG. 11, to highlight that the annotation N1 corresponds to the voice of the visualization component VP6. It must be noted that the annotation N1 and the visualization component VP6 and their corresponding speech can be associated according to the time they were received/recorded. Thereafter, the user 7 and the user 8 respectively speak, and the voice management device successively recognizes the received voice and displays them as visual components (VP7, VP8), as shown in FIG. Similarly, when the voice management device receives the voice of the corresponding user 8, the specific device can receive the annotation N2 corresponding to the voice. It must be noted that each of the speeches in the previous examples is described in a different user perspective. However, in some examples, the speech of different segments may be the same user. Whether the received voice is corresponding to the same user may be determined according to the position set by each of the sounding units in the electronic device and the result of the sound size and/or voiceprint comparison of the specific voice received by each of the sounding units.

值得注意的是,視覺化部件可以被選擇。在一些實施例中,使用者介面中可以僅顯示被選定之視覺化部件。另外,在一些實施例中,並未被選擇之視覺化部件可以被刪除。再者,在一些實施例中,被選定之視覺化部件可以組成具有一特定格式之一語音檔。此外,相應語音之視覺化部件與註解間亦可以依據其接收之時間來進行各種管理。在一例子中,當選擇一註解時,相應此選定註解之語音的視覺化部件可以移動至一顯示範圍之最上方,且相應之語音被進行播放。在另一例子中,當選擇一視覺化部件時,此選定視覺化部件之語音所相應之註解會移動至顯示範圍之最上方,並進行標示。It is worth noting that the visual components can be selected. In some embodiments, only the selected visualization component may be displayed in the user interface. Additionally, in some embodiments, visual components that are not selected may be deleted. Moreover, in some embodiments, the selected visualization component can compose a voice file having a particular format. In addition, the visual components and annotations of the corresponding speech can also be managed in accordance with the time of reception. In an example, when an annotation is selected, the visual component corresponding to the selected annotation voice can be moved to the top of a display range and the corresponding speech is played. In another example, when a visualization component is selected, the annotation corresponding to the voice of the selected visualization component moves to the top of the display range and is labeled.

注意的是,當特定語音被接收期間可以於電子裝置或與電子裝置耦接之特定裝置上接收註記輸入。然而,在一些實施例中,當特定語音接收並記錄之後,亦可接收相關之註記輸入。如前所述,接收之語音 可以分別顯示為視覺化部件,且可以被進行選擇。在一些實施例中,當會議結束之後,使用者可以利用觸控式螢幕檢視相應此會議語音之視覺化部件。當使用者欲對於一特定語音視覺化部件進行註解時,使用者可以藉由於觸控式螢幕按著此特定語音視覺化部件,並輸入相關註解。It is noted that the annotation input can be received on the electronic device or a particular device coupled to the electronic device during the particular speech being received. However, in some embodiments, the associated annotation input may also be received after the particular voice is received and recorded. As mentioned earlier, the received voice It can be displayed as a visual component separately and can be selected. In some embodiments, after the conference is over, the user can view the visual component corresponding to the conference voice using a touch screen. When the user wants to annotate a specific voice visualizing component, the user can visualize the component by pressing the touch screen and input the attention solution.
